Bug description:
  Please sync lazr.restfulclient 0.11.1-1 (main) from Debian experimental (main)

Explanation of the Ubuntu delta and why it can be dropped:
dh_python2 has the same namespace of python-central, so Ubuntu
delta can be safely dropped. New upstream versions included in Debian already.

Changelog entries since current natty version 0.9.20-0ubuntu1:

lazr.restfulclient (0.11.1-1) experimental; urgency=low

  * New upstream release.
  * Switch to dh_python2.
  * debian/control:
    - Bump Standards-Version to 3.9.1, no changes required.
  * debian/pydist-overrides:
    - Do not require lazr.authentication as dependency.

 -- Luca Falavigna <dktrkranz at debian.org>  Sat, 04 Dec 2010 12:53:58 +0100
